So this year as we started and submitted to God petitions that we need in our lives, I started to look into prayer
Why do we pray? What’s the purpose of prayer? Why don’t we get our prayers answered?
Then bigger questions developed...
“If God is sovereign, then why should we pray?”
“If God is God and isn’t influenced by man, then why ask if He will do what pleases Him, anyways?”
If prayer works, then why are prayer meetings the smallest service the church has?
So these questions forced me, to look at the issue… Is prayer even working? Are we praying correctly?
I started to look for the source, original purpose and what principles are used to understand prayer.
So it took me to where we were last week, the beginning of prayer and where it originated
To understand prayer you first need to understand, Why it was created...
Prayer was created because of 2 words, “Let them” have dominion not let us but let them have dominion, who? Man (mankind)
Humans - humus means dirt and man which means spirit, spirit with a dirt body have the dominion to operate on earth and have the authority
So we looked deeper into the purpose of man, and why God created man...
3 principles that you and I must understand before we can understand prayer
God is as sovereign as His word. (When God speaks it becomes law)
God is limited by His word. (God must do what He says)
God will never violate His word. (God is faithful to His word even if it means the fall of mankind )
So through all of this prayer was created, what is prayer?
Prayer is earthly license for heavenly interference
In the bible you will always see that God only moved with the cooperation of man
Abraham and Sodom and Gomorrah
Noah and the destruction and deliverance of mankind
Moses and the exit of God’s people from Egypt
Esther and the deliverance of the Jews

When used correctly prayer is the most powerful authority you have. God has the power but we carry the authority.
Here are 7 primary laws to understand from “Let them “
The legal authority to dominate earth was given to mankind only
God did not include Himself in the legal authority structure over the earth
Man became the legal steward of the earth domain.
Man is a spirit with a physical body, therefore only spirits with physical bodies can legally function in the earth realm
Any spirit without a body is illegal here on earth
Any influence or interference from the supernatural realm on earth is only legal through mankind
God himself, made himself subject to this law as well

Here are some kingdom facts and truths
“PRINCIPLES
1. God’s original plan in creation was to extend His heavenly Kingdom on earth.
2. God’s purpose was to establish a family of sons, not servants.
3. God’s purpose was to establish a Kingdom of sons, not subjects.
4. God’s purpose was to establish a commonwealth of citizens, not Christians.
5. God’s purpose was to establish relationships, not religion.
6. God’s original purpose and intent was to rule the seen from the unseen through the unseen living in the seen on the scene.
7. Human beings were created to exercise dominion over the earth and all its creatures.
8. God gave us rulership of the earth, not ownership.
9. God will not do anything on earth without permission or access from those on earth to whom He gave dominion.
10. God can do anything, but because He has given us the license, He can release on the earth only what we allow.”
“11. The Gospel of the Kingdom is good news: a message sent from Daddy to all His children telling them that they can return home to the Kingdom and once again be sons and daughters in their full right.”

Let’s review and have an understanding of what we know so far
To understand prayer and it’s purpose you MUST understand God’s plan for it, not man’s.
To understand God’s plan you need to understand what was His original intent for man and for earth.
God will never violate His word, God gave man legal authority on earth to dominate it.
Man’s purpose is to move God’s kingdom on earth as it is in heaven, so we will need to understand heavens mandates and principles.
We are ambassadors of Christ, sent from heaven to colonize and represent heaven on earth.
We need to learn the art of prayer, it is a learned activity
Prayer is always always about the will of the Father, if you don’t know it then stop praying...
Prayer is earthly license for heavenly interference.
